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from The O2 Arena to Neath is to bus which costs £13 - £55 and takes 5h 56m.
The fastest way to get from The O2 Arena to Neath is to train which takes 3h 35m and costs £55 - £160.
No, there is no direct train from The O2 Arena station to Neath. However, there are services departing from North Greenwich station and arriving at Neath via Bond Street Station and London Paddington.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 35m.
The distance between The O2 Arena and Neath is 193 miles. The road distance is 191.6 miles.
The best way to get from The O2 Arena to Neath without a car is to train which takes 3h 35m and costs £55 - £160.
It takes approximately 3h 35m to get from The O2 Arena to Neath, including transfers.
The O2 Arena to Neath train services, operated by Great Western Railway (GWR), depart from London Paddington station.
The best way to get from The O2 Arena to Neath is to train which takes 3h 35m and costs £55 - £160.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s £13 - £55 and takes 5h 56m.
The O2 Arena to Neath train services, operated by Great Western Railway (GWR), arrive at Neath station.
Yes, the driving distance between The O2 Arena to Neath is 192 miles. It takes approximately 3h 43m to drive from The O2 Arena to Neath.
